WebHere’s a breakdown of the time frame during the day for dogs of different ages. Puppies 8 to 10 Weeks Old – 30 to 60 minutes. Puppies 11 to 14 Weeks Old – 1 to 3 hours. Puppies 15 to 16 Weeks Old – 3 to 4 hours. Puppies over 17 Weeks and Adult Dogs – 4 to 5 hours. You’ll notice that the list stopped with 4 to 5 hours. WebSo, a 2-month-old puppy can usually hold it for three hours, and a 3-month-old puppy can generally hold it for four hours. Schade says that it’s better to be safe than sorry and to use your puppy’s age as a good estimate for how long he can go between bathroom breaks.

Web27 mei 2024 · It can take weeks for your dog to get used to crate time. Feed your dog meals in the crate to get them excited. If you fill a bowl with a little bit of food, you can have them eat inside with the crate door closed. Once they finish eating, take them outside to eliminate and let them out of the crate.
